Output 25703aef7be3c88c1ffc32ed7829be044bb3bdb56a668dd57cbd3a0cd92ee21e:1

value
29600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df4b5ca284d4542b94fa8f62d70af9edf250e1bb OP_EQUALVERIFY OP_CHECKSIG
address
1MMfy1gD5tHQx4uvExEU8z33emaRUyJuqg
transaction
25703aef7be3c88c1ffc32ed7829be044bb3bdb56a668dd57cbd3a0cd92ee21e
spent
true